My daughter is turning 2 next month and my son is 5 days old, my daughters tantrums are becoming so bad, she can’t say many words yet but does have good understanding of what you are saying to her and if she is told no she will scream so loud and tense up and shake, sometimes there’s no reasoning with her at all i really feel like im failing her

I’m so sorry you’re going through this. Parenting is hard isn’t it and such a minefield.

does distraction help or just plain ignoring the tantrum so she’s not getting any reenforcement from her tantrums. I used to do that with my daughter and just sort of walk into the other room and then when she calmed down we would have a cuddle then.

have you got anyone who can have her for a night just so you can get a break and a rest. It will get easier. I know everyone says that but before you know it it really will be better xx
